About the show
Swedish duo First Aid Kit return to London this September for a very special one-night-only performance at the Hall on Tuesday 29 September 2026. After two years off the road, the band will take to the iconic stage accompanied by a sixty five piece symphony orchestra.
For this unique show, First Aid Kit will perform their breakthrough album Stay Gold in full for the first half of the evening. The second half will feature a selection of favourite songs, old and new. This marks the band’s second time playing at the Hall, the last time was in 2014 in support of Stay Gold.

First Aid Kit
Swedish duo First Aid Kit, as their name suggests, will heal and ease the pain. Comprising sisters Johanna and Klara Söderberg, their soothing brand of Indie-Folk with the odd hint of Country has seen them grow from cult status to playing sell-out tours and achieving gold and platinum albums with 'The Lion's Roar' and 'Stay Gold'. They have worked with Jack White, sung for Patti Smith and toured with Bright Eyes and Lykke Li.
